    Just Straight Talk Tell It As It Is!

    20 May 2020 by Mazeline Hemmings

    Just Straight Talk have been successful in applying to the Coronavirus Resilience Fund Grant through Heart of England Community Foundation.

    The grant of £3,000 has enabled JST to provide a welfare fund to support people in the community with PPE for those living in fear and anxiety due to Covid-19. The grant also pays for the delivery of fish and chip shop suppers and emergency crisis food and essentials to people who are shielding, the isolated, the lonely and people who are poorly.

    Project Manager, Kate, says “We are so grateful for this fund which will provide a lifeline for so many people living in Sandwell and Dudley who have been adversely affected by the lockdown and by the worry and fear that Covid-19 has created.

    The fund application was streamlined and straightforward. We received the outcome decision in less than two weeks. I would recommend groups and organisations apply to the Resilience Fund with their ideas as soon as possible”

    The Fund is available to organisations in Birmingham, Solihull, Coventry, Warwickshire and the Black Country.
